Trunk, Svn Rev 1027765 Hej Sabine, the paste action only works for address books that actually support the paste/creation of collections. The vCard address book for example doesn't support subcollections, only items. Please check with akonadiconsole whether the collection you try to paste a collection in really has the Create Collection ACL set.
